www.lpgas.co.zaEstablished in 1987 and based in Johannesburg, the Liquefied Petroleum Gas Association of South Africa (LPGSA) is a non-profit company (NPC) that represents companies that are involved in the installation, distribution, hardware, and retailing of LP Gas and gas appliances. As the industry body, we are dedicated to the safe use of LP Gas, everywhere in South Africa – in domestic, commercial, and industrial applications as well as many other industries. The LPGSSA works very closely with the various Government Departments including but not limited to, the Department of Labour, Department of Energy, the South Africa Bureau of Standards (SABS), and the various Fire Departments in the control and approval of all LP Gas sites, SABS National Standards and the Codes and Practices as they pertain to the industry. The LP Gas Safety Association promotes safety in the industry and to this end presents a variety of training courses to cover all needs. In terms of the Occupational Health and Safety Act (OHS) and lead pressure equipment regulations, only registered LP Gas Practitioners shall install and/or maintain LP Gas installations.
